Thunderbirds end Gold Miners win streak

SAULT STE. MARIE, Ont. – A three-goal first period supplied the Soo Thunderbirds all they would need before eventually settling for a 4-2 victory over the Kirkland Lake Gold Miners in Northern Ontario Junior Hockey League action Saturday at Essar Centre.

The triumph by Sault Ste. Marie also put an end to Kirkland Lake’s season-high nine-game winning streak.

It was all Thunderbirds in the opening frame starting with a Jaren Bellini effort at 6:40.

Midway through the first the home team went up by a pair on Nathan Hebert’s power play tally.

The T-Birds then made it 3-0 at the 13-minute mark when Darian Pilon finished off the work of Aiden Salerno and Brett Jeffries.

The Soo then chased Kirkland Lake starter Victor-Olivier Courchesne 100 seconds into the middle stanza courtesy of Matthew Caruso.

Tyler Mazzocato came in the rest of the way for the Gold Miners and the move sparked the visitors as they tallied twice in a nine-second span on a pair of quick markers from Logan Fredericks to make it 4-2 with still 16:48 to play in the second.

However the two sides tightened up defensively from there and there would be no more scoring the rest of the night.

Jeffries had a pair of assists to help the Thunderbirds cause.

Connor Ryckman made 14 saves to pick-up the win for the Soo.

Courchesne suffered the loss allowing the four against on 19 attempts.

Mazzocato meanwhile stopped all 18 shots he faced in a long relief stint for the Gold Miners.
